#e7056a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e7056a is composed of 90.6% red, 2% green and 41.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.8% magenta, 54.1%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 333.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 46.3%. #e7056a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0ad4 with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

#e7056a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e7056a has RGB values of R:231, G:5, B:106 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.54,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15140202.

Shades and Tints of #e7056a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#ffecf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7056a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7276 is the less saturated color, while #e7056a is the most saturated one.
